- For the chapter, see My Imaginary Friend....
"My Imaginary Friend" is the sixth track on the Beyond: Two Souls Original Soundtrack. It was composed by Lorne Balfe and produced by Hans Zimmer.
"My Imaginary Friend" is the sixth track on the Beyond: Two Souls Original Soundtrack. It was composed by Lorne Balfe and produced by Hans Zimmer.